Tigers bust open game with four goals in final period



Emilee Wolf scored three goals and received assists from Alli Wielinski all three times as the New Richmond Tigers beat the Fox Cities Stars 6-1 Saturday afternoon in Wisconsin Rapids.

The second game of the Wisconsin River Classic started with lots of defense and goaltending, but ended with four Tiger goals in the final period.

Wolf scored on a rebound with 35 seconds left in the first period to start the scoring. The Stars held the edge in shots (15-9) but trailed by one on the scoreboard when the period ended.

Ashley Dusek scored from the left dot one minute into the second to give the Tigers a 2-0 lead. 

The Stars cut the lead to 2-1 with Nicole Barfknecht's power play rebound at 7:03. That's how the period ended, but this time New Richmond held the shot edge (16-9).

The third period was all New Richmond, as Wolf scored twice in the first eight and one-half minutes, along with a goal each from Kaylee Bebeau and Dusek.

Shots were nearly even, with the Tigers holding a 7-6 advantage.

Tigers goalie Baily Lund stopped 29 shots in the game, while freshman Morgan Talbot had 26 saves for the Stars.

New Richmond (1-1) moves into the championship game against Bay Area at 6:45pm, while the Stars (1-3) head into the consolation game at 4:30 against host Point-Rapids.
